When you go camping in Sweden, you'll experience pristine nature, Nordic calmness and won't have to fear drowning in mass tourism. The country is very expansive and provides different natural sceneries. In Gothenland - especially in the province Scania - you'll camp in your private Bullerby: Red timber houses, deep forests and a pleasant climate characterise this region.

Crystal clear lakes and small islands off the coast of the Swedish capital Stockholm make campers' hearts beat faster in Swealand. Jump in the cool water and discover the region from your canoe.

The trip to Northland takes a bit longer, but you'll be rewarded with the midnight sun or the polar light. No matter which region you choose: Sweden will certainly fulfill your personal holiday dream. We introduce you to the most beautiful holiday regions for camping in Sweden!

Camping at Lake Vänern in Sweden

Camping at the largest lake in Sweden is particularly beautiful. Its diverse nature reserves, like the Djüro National Park or the Natural Reserve Surö, make the lake especially popular with nature-loving campers. If you like an active holiday you certainly won't miss out here either. Water sports such as boating, stand-up paddling or swimming give you the chance to really let off some steam.

What Campers Should Know About Camping in Sweden

Light’s On!

When you drive on Swedish roads and motorways, you must always have your vehicle's dipped headlights turned on, even if you’re travelling during the day, and the sun is shining.

Stay High and Dry

The drink-drive limit in Sweden is 0.02% or 20 mg/l. The authorities take drinking and driving very seriously, and they regularly test drivers for alcohol. These tests don’t always happen at night either; sometimes, they’ll occur early in the morning. Drivers are typically checked when getting on or off of ferries.

Alcohol Comes at a Price

Food prices in Sweden are the fifth-highest in Europe, around 10–20% higher than average. That doesn’t mean that you have to empty the contents of your entire fridge into your motorhome before you head out on holiday: Swedish discount grocery stories are quite affordable. The only exception is alcohol, which is expensive and only available in Systembolaget, a government-owned chain of liquor stores. You could end up spending two or three times the price you’re used to for a bottle of beer!

Fishing Licence Required?

Many people falsely believe that the Everyman’s right means that there are no rules or limits for fishing in Sweden. Actually, you don’t need a fishing licence if you plan to stick to the coast or the five largest lakes (Vänern, Vättern, Mälaren, Storsjön, and Hjälmaren). For any other body of water, though, you will need a licence, which you can purchase at tourist offices, kiosks, petrol stations or from machines set up near the water.
